Our Duties, Authorities, and Responsibilities

Authority

The Directorate of Administrative and Financial Affairs, established by merging the Directorate of Control and the Directorate of Support Services as stipulated in Decree Law No. 124, is included in the Administrative Organization Chart of our University in accordance with Decree Law No. 190.

Duties

  • Our unit implements expenditures at the release rate specified in the budget implementation instructions within the scope of budget arrangements, procurement of services and all kinds of goods and materials required for the service.
  • The Rectorate Central Organization and all units with independent budgets purchase fixed assets and machinery equipment and carry out the related accrual procedures.
  • Performing annual maintenance and repairs of vehicles. Conducting procurement tenders for fixed assets and materials exceeding the direct procurement limit of our University Rectorate and all affiliated units in accordance with the Public Procurement Law No. 4734.
  • Procuring goods and materials required by our University units through the State Materials Office and performing advance and payment transactions.
  • Conducting tenders for the rental of real estate under the State Procurement Law No. 2886.
  • Providing transportation for technical trips organized by all units of our university to enhance education and training.
  • Providing transportation for our university staff in connection with their official duties.
  • Providing transportation for participants and officials at conferences and symposiums. Assigning the necessary vehicles/equipment to deliver purchased materials to the units.
  • To carry out other duties assigned by the Rector and the Secretary General.
